Mobile Suit Gundam SEED Destiny: Generation of C.E. for the PlayStation 2 is a turn-based tactical RPG developed by Tom Create and published by Bandai in 2005. Unlike the more common SD (Super Deformed) style of the G Generation series, this title features full-size mecha models with cel-shaded 3D animations. English Translation & Patch Status

As of April 2026, there is no official English release for the original PS2 game. Fans typically rely on the following methods to play in English:

Translation Guides: Since the gameplay is simple and formulaic, many fans use translation guides from sites like GameFAQs to navigate menus and understand pilot skills.

Modern Alternatives: A remastered version of the related title "Mobile Suit Gundam SEED Battle Destiny" was released in 2025 for Nintendo Switch and PC with official English text support. Gameplay Overview

Tactical Strategy: The game uses a hex-based map system similar to Super Robot Wars.

Campaign Scope: The story covers events from C.E. 71 and C.E. 73, including the original SEED and Destiny timelines, as well as spin-offs like Astray and Stargazer.

Customization: Players can collect over 100 different mobile suits and modify them between missions by upgrading mobility, weapon power, and defense.

Visual Flair: Combat is showcased through 3D cel-shaded animations that aim to match the anime's aesthetic. Review Summary Mobile Suit Gundam SEED Destiny: Generation of C.E.

Mobile Suit Gundam SEED Destiny: Generation of C.E. (PS2, 2005) is a highly-regarded strategy title, it is important to note that no complete English fan translation patch exists for this specific game as of April 2026.

Below is a detailed guide on the game's status, how to play it in English via alternative means, and common misconceptions regarding other Gundam SEED patches. 1. Project Status: Why There is No Patch Technical Barriers

: The game's engine, developed by Tom Create, differs from the more commonly patched SD Gundam G Generation

series. Its complex menu systems and hardcoded Japanese text have historically discouraged dedicated translation groups. Regional Exclusivity

: The game was released only in Japan and never received an official localization or an "Asia English" version, which some later Gundam titles benefited from. 2. How to Play in English (Alternative Solutions)

Since a direct patch is unavailable, players typically use the following community resources to navigate the game: English Menu & Gameplay Guides : The most comprehensive resource is the Generation of C.E. FAQ/Walkthrough on GameFAQs

, which provides full translations for menus, unit names, pilot stats, and mission objectives. Translation Tools

: Many players use mobile translation apps (like Google Lens) or OCR (Optical Character Recognition) software to translate text in real-time while playing via emulator or on hardware. Cheat Codes

: For those looking to bypass grinding due to language barriers, Codebreaker Action Replay

codes are available to unlock all mobile suits and characters. 3. Common Misconceptions & Other Patched Games
